Ten-member TT team for Incheon Games

Mumbai :  A 10-member (5 men and 5 women) table tennis team will be representing India at the Incheon Asian Games, beginning September 19. The team was selected on the basis of the players’ national and international ranking, besides keeping in mind the current form of the individual players after the Inter-Institutional championships held in New Delhi in the third week of August.

The Table Tennis Federation of India (TTFI) had sent the names to the Indian Olympic Association (IOA) which, in turn, had recommended them to the Sports Ministry for clearance. Though there were speculations about the teams’ clearance in the media, the TTFI was always sure of getting the sports ministry nod.

The paddlers will leave for the South Korean city on September 22 and the table tennis events at the Asian Games begin from September 27.

TTFI secretary-general Dhanraj Choudhary said that he was confident of getting the sports ministry’s clearance for his team. “We had projected a clear picture about why our paddlers should compete at the Asiad. Our paddlers had reached the semifinals at Guangzhou and that was good enough reason for their representation. Both the SAI and ministry officials were convinced,” said Choudhary.
